About

Bernard Dallemagne is a pioneering figure in surgical robotics and minimally invasive gastrointestinal surgery. His research centers on developing and validating advanced robotic platforms to overcome the limitations of conventional flexible endoscopy, particularly for complex procedures like endoscopic submucosal dissection (ESD). Dallemagne’s major contributions include the creation of a novel telemanipulated robotic assistant for surgical endoscopy, which enables endoluminal surgical triangulation—a critical advancement for performing precise resections within the GI tract. His work has been highly influential, with his 2017 paper on the robotic assistant for ESD garnering 132 citations, and his subsequent studies on flexible surgical robots and artificial intelligence in surgery accumulating over 50 citations each. Beyond technical innovation, Dallemagne has explored the democratization of advanced endoscopic techniques, demonstrating single-operator fully robotic colorectal ESD in preclinical models. He also co-founded the journal *Artificial Intelligence Surgery* and developed the Business Engineering Surgical Technologies (BEST) teaching method to incubate talent for surgical innovation. His research continues to shape the future of digital surgery and robotic-assisted endoscopy.
